Freeze-thaw damage on stucco base coats: recognizing it early and rebuilding the right way

Introduction Freeze-thaw damage occurs when trapped moisture in stucco base coats freezes and expands, causing cracking and delamination. It can weaken the surface and open pathways for water to enter surrounding layers. Damage often starts on the exterior and can spread if not addressed with proper repairs. Common signs include hairline cracks, chipped or powdery areas, and small spalls that reveal underlying layers. Inspect after winter or any time you…
